
How Rhythmic Gymnastics in Brentwood Develops Creativity and Self-Expression
Rhythmic gymnastics is a captivating sport that blends athletic ability with artistic performance. It sets itself apart from other forms of gymnastics by incorporating creative movement, musical expression, and the use of apparatuses such as ribbons, hoops, and balls. Beyond its physical benefits, rhythmic gymnastics offers an extraordinary outlet for creativity and self-expression. Creative Freedom Through Movement
In rhythmic gymnastics, athletes have the opportunity to move creatively to music, allowing them to express emotions and themes through their performances. Each routine is choreographed to match the tempo, rhythm, and mood of the chosen music, giving gymnasts the freedom to develop their interpretations. This creative freedom encourages athletes to explore different forms of movement, from slow and graceful sequences to fast, dynamic performances.

Combining Athletic and Artistic Skills
Rhythmic gymnastics is a unique sport because it combines athletic skill with artistic creativity. Athletes need strength, flexibility, and coordination to perform demanding physical movements, but they must also use creativity to design routines that showcase their artistic flair. In Brentwood, rhythmic gymnasts learn to balance these two elements, crafting performances that blend technical excellence with creative expression.
Working with apparatuses like hoops, ribbons, and balls also encourages innovation. Athletes need to think creatively about how to integrate these objects into their routines, coming up with original ways to enhance their performance. Whether they’re twirling a ribbon or tossing a hoop, each apparatus opens up new opportunities for creative exploration.

The Role of Music in Self-Expression
Music is a central part of rhythmic gymnastics, helping athletes connect emotionally with their routines. Gymnasts choose music that resonates with them, adding another layer of creativity to their performances. Whether it’s a classical piece or a contemporary song, the music guides the movement, helping athletes express their emotions through dance-like choreography.
